A modern logging library with a fluent API for specifying log messages, metadata and errors
Shared utilities and types for loglayer packages.
Base transport used to implement logging transports for loglayer.
Base plugin used to implement plugins for loglayer.
Base context manager used to implement context managers for loglayer.
Pino transport for the LogLayer logging library.
DataDog transport for the LogLayer logging library.
Log redaction plugin for loglayer.
Base log level manager used to implement log level managers for loglayer.
Adds statsd / hot-shots functionality to LogLayer.
Pretty log output in the terminal / browser / Next.js for the LogLayer logging library.
sprintf plugin for loglayer.
Datadog Browser Logs transport for the LogLayer logging library.
Sentry transport for the LogLayer logging library.
HTTP transport for the LogLayer logging library.
tslog transport for the LogLayer logging library.
Injects DataDog APM traces to logs in LogLayer.
OpenTelemetry transport for LogLayer for use with log processors.
OpenTelemetry plugin for LogLayer that adds trace context to logs.
Winston transport for the LogLayer logging library.
Axiom.co transport for the LogLayer logging library.
Interactive pretty log output in the terminal for the LogLayer logging library.
Hono integration for LogLayer with request-scoped logging, auto request logging, and error handling.
Better Stack transport for the LogLayer logging library.
A simple alternative to the tower service layer, implemented using async trait, making the code more concise and easier to use.
Build composable async services with layered middleware.
Tracing output formatters
Tracing output formatters